Grasping LLC Structures

Limited Liability Companies, or Limited Liability Companies, are a well-liked business structure in the United States due to their flexibility and safeguards for owners. An LLC blends the characteristics of a company and a partnership, providing protection from personal liability for its owners while allowing for pass-through taxation. This means that the earnings and deficits of the LLC can be reported on the owners’ personal tax returns, avoiding the double taxation that companies often face.

LLCs are formed at the regional level, meaning that the laws governing them can change significantly from one jurisdiction to another. For example, a Texas LLC search may result in different compliance standards compared to a Floridian LLC inquiry or a Wyomingite LLC inquiry. Each jurisdiction has its own rules regarding creation, maintenance, and termination, which is important for entrepreneurs to know when selecting where to establish their enterprise.

Another key aspect of LLCs is the operating agreement, which details the governance structure and operating procedures of the company. This agreement is crucial as it regulates the relationship between the members and can outline the percentage of ownership, profit sharing, and decision-making processes. As companies expand and develop, having a explicit operating agreement can help prevent conflicts among owners and provide a definite structure for governance.

Texas Limited Liability Company Search Explained

The Texan Limited Liability Company inquiry is an essential tool for entrepreneurs and businesses looking to set up or explore LLCs within the region. By navigating the Texan State Secretary's online registry, individuals can find valuable information about existing LLCs, including their identities, status of registration, and the information of their authorized representatives. This transparency enables informed decision-making for future business owners and investors.

Carrying out a Texan Limited Liability Company inquiry not only reveals the names of registered companies but also assists verify the availability of business names. It ensures that new LLC owners can pick a distinct name that complies with regional regulations, sidestepping potential law-related conflicts. Additionally, the inquiry gives insights into a company’s operational status, permitting users to verify whether an entity is functioning, not active, or has been dissolved.

In addition, the Texas LLC search serves as a defense against potential deception. By confirming the validity of an Limited Liability Company, interested parties can shield themselves from fraudulent activities. Whether you are looking to partner with another business, acquire products, or conduct due diligence, employing the Texan Limited Liability Company inquiry is a essential step in managing the corporate landscape efficiently.

Florida LLC Inquiry Overview

The inquiry for LLCs, or Limited Liability Companies, in Florida is an crucial tool for entrepreneurs and individuals seeking to create or investigate companies within the state. The State of Florida's Division of Corporations provides an online platform that allows users to perform comprehensive searches on registered LLCs. This tool is vital for understanding the condition, ownership, and regulatory status of prospective business partners or competitors.

When performing a FL LLC inquiry, individuals can access important details such as the entity designation, registration date, and the status of the LLC, whether it is active, inactive, or dissolved. Additionally, the search results may include the address of the registered agent and the principal office, providing valuable information into the location and structure of the company. This information is crucial for individuals looking to verify the validity of a business before entering into any legal or monetary agreements.

Moreover, a FL LLC inquiry can highlight any documentations associated with the entity, including changes, annual reports, or time-sensitive documents. This comprehensive view into the functional history of a company allows partners to make well-informed decisions. Ultimately, utilizing the FL LLC search not only promotes openness but also encourages confidence in the local entrepreneurial ecosystem.

Wyoming LLC Search Information

This state is known for its favorable environment, making it a popular choice for establishing Limited Liability Companies. This clarity is beneficial for prospective investors, partners, and clients who wish to conduct due diligence before engaging with a business.

Performing a Wyoming LLC search is simple and can be conducted via the internet through the Wyoming Secretary of State's portal. The intuitive interface enables users to quickly input company details, making it easy to access essential information. Additionally, the state offers choices to search by different criteria, such as entity name or filing number, which ensures that users can locate the information they need effectively.

One of the key advantages of creating an LLC in Wyoming is the state’s confidentiality regulations, which allow for increased anonymity for business owners. This can be particularly appealing for business owners who wish to keep their names private from the public. However, it is still important for those seeking to interact with a Wyoming LLC to make use of the search tool to validate legitimacy and understand the business structure. This understanding ensures informed decisions are made when dealing with companies in this jurisdiction.
